I've a similar problem where ispconfig will create a database in the admin panel but it does not actually show up in mysql, which basically the new database is not being created I suppose I'm also unable to run updates because of it. When I run ispconfig_update.php an error stating it could not log on as root@localhost.
If I use
Code:
mysql -uroot -ppassword
I can log on to mysql as root.
I've tried setting /usr/local/ispconfig/server/lib/conf.inc.php
and entering the root user and password (since I do not know what the password of the ispconfig user in mysql is) under the section //** Database
I do not think that worked.
The hostname of the box was also changed but here's the output of:
Code:
hostname -f
hostname: Unknown host
I have had to reset the admin user to get into ispconfig's admin panel. The login does work.
not sure if that is related to the mysql issue. This is ISPConfig 3.0.16 on CentOS. Any thoughts?
